Royals and Twins Prepare for Critical Divisional Showdown
On the evening of April 1, 2026, at 6:40 PM UTC, the Kansas City Royals are scheduled to host the Minnesota Twins in a highly anticipated baseball game. This encounter holds particular significance for the Royals, who, with a current record of two wins and two losses, are on the cusp of securing their inaugural divisional series triumph of the season. A victory in this game would not only grant them the series win but also position them for a potential sweep in the following day's matchup, marking a strong start to their 2026 campaign.
Taking the mound for the Royals will be Noah Cameron, embarking on his sophomore season. Cameron, who demonstrated exceptional performance during his rookie year, is expected to bring that same level of skill and determination to this critical game. His ability to perform under pressure will be key for Kansas City as they face a tough opponent. The Twins, in turn, will rely on the seasoned arm of Joe Ryan, a pitcher who has historically been a thorn in the side of the Royals. Ryan's impressive career ERA of 2.02 over eleven starts against Kansas City highlights his dominance in this rivalry. However, a notable breakthrough occurred last September when the Royals managed to put up five runs against Ryan in a mere two innings, suggesting a shift in dynamic that could influence tonight's outcome.
The Royals' lineup for this pivotal game is reported to be standard, with no unexpected changes, indicating a strategic approach to maintain consistency and leverage their established strengths.
